Função lineShutdown (tapi.h)

A função lineShutdown desliga o uso do aplicativo da abstração de linha da API.

Sintaxe

LONG lineShutdown(
  HLINEAPP hLineApp
);

Parâmetros

hLineApp

Identificador de uso do aplicativo para a API de linha.

Retornar valor

Retornará zero se a solicitação for bem-sucedida ou um número de erro negativo se ocorrer um erro. Os valores retornados possíveis são:

LINEERR_INVALAPPHANDLE, LINEERR_RESOURCEUNAVAIL, LINEERR_NOMEM, LINEERR_UNINITIALIZED.

Comentários

Se essa função for chamada quando o aplicativo tiver linhas abertas ou chamadas ativas, os identificadores de chamada serão excluídos e o TAPI executará automaticamente o equivalente a um lineClose em cada linha aberta. No entanto, é recomendável que os aplicativos fechem explicitamente todas as linhas abertas antes de invocar lineShutdown. Se o desligamento for executado enquanto as solicitações assíncronas estiverem pendentes, essas solicitações serão canceladas.

Requisitos

Requisito Valor
Plataforma de Destino Windows
Cabeçalho tapi.h
Biblioteca Tapi32.lib
DLL Tapi32.dll

Confira também

Referência básica dos Serviços de Telefonia

Visão geral da referência do TAPI 2.2

Lineclose